Quarterly Planning Note — Sales Leads

Heads up, team: leadership is seriously weighing an acquisition of Bramblepoint Labs to round out our analytics offering. Nothing is signed, so keep pipeline conversations neutral if customers ask. Expect a briefing pack once diligence wraps. Keep Q3 targets unchanged for now. The confidential note on where this fits our plans sits just below.

board note of baweg-bawig: Project Tamath slips by six weeks because of the audit delay.

Subject: Scheduled key rotation — Quillbase schema registry

Hi on-call,

At 02:00 Tuesday we rotate the credential that producers use to fetch and publish event schemas from Quillbase. Both old and new keys remain valid for a six-hour overlap; after that, the old key is revoked and lookups will return 401. Please update the paging runbook and the canary consumer config tonight. The new key follows.

API key for fahip-kahip: zpat23_XiJGUHz5xfaAtaIqUkus0rh

Hi Verla — we rotated the credential used by Stillcreek's incremental rebuild hook this morning. Partial rebuilds will fail with a 403 until the deploy pipeline picks up the new value; full rebuilds are unaffected. Please update the release config before tonight's cut. The new key for the rebuild service is below.

gateway credential: kto3_qfe

## Changelog — Quarrelet API v3.8

Changed defaults: the GraphQL resolver layer now batches nested lookups through the new dataloader, eliminating the N+1 query pattern that was hammering the orders table. Batch windows default to 10ms and cap at 200 keys; both were previously unbounded. Teams relying on per-row resolver side effects should note those now fire once per batch. Cache hints are propagated automatically, so manual priming is no longer needed. The service now boots with the default configuration values shown below.

settings of bawif-fawif:
ralix:
  log_level: warn
  metrics_host: metrics.ralix.tolvaqsys.internal
  pool_size: 32

TURN-208: Gatevale turnstile counters at the Merrow Field pilot double-count when a rotation reverses mid-cycle. Attendance totals drift roughly 2% high per event. The debounce window fix is implemented, reviewed by Ilsa, and soak-tested across two simulated match days without drift. Ready for your cut; the candidate build is identified below.

trace token, tagag-tafog: htk6_5ed18c